So, here comes the Dashe, made by husband-and-wife wine-making team Michael and Anne Dashe. It is a first-rate Zin that shows the variety’s briary power: It’s got dark flavors of licorice, spice, supple black cherry and blueberry plus ripe tannins and a lingering vanilla-accented finish.
